Over her twenty-two years of teaching, Kim Alexander's goals have changed. Not only does she focus on covering the curriculum with her young students, she is also keenly aware of their mental health and has developed ways to create
a safe place in the classroom where students feel that they are seen and heard and that what they say matters.
As a result of her techniques to encourage young students to feel safe expressing themselves, they also do better academically.
In Creating a Safe Space in the Classroom: A Guide for Educators
, you will learn how to
build a safe environment in the classroom
for learning and supporting mental health, maintaining this environment, and ways to
support mental health through assertiveness techniques
. Also covered are the
signs a teacher can look for in the classroom
that indicate various mental health disorders such as
Anxiety, Depression, Obsessive Compulsive Disorder, Eating Disorders
, and more. Other areas include the need to recognize all groups of students-Indigenous students, students of colour, newcomers to Canada, LGBTQ+ students, and students with special needs.
